WebJan 9, 2024 · TENS therapy uses a small, battery-powered device to deliver electrical impulses through electrodes placed directly on your skin. Experts hold two theories about how transcutaneous electrical nerve stimulation works. Both involve tricking your brain by blocking its perception of pain — the first by stimulating the nerve cells and the second ... A: A TENS machine works by sending electrical impulses via electrodes placed on the skin near the site of … mylondon strictlyWebApr 2, 2024 · The TENS unit has 2 control knobs. One control knob makes the electrical signals strong or weak. The other control knob makes the electrical signals fast or slow. Turn the control knobs to the off position before you start. Use rubbing alcohol to clean the skin where the electrodes will be placed.
